Hamsters are notion to be at first from the wasteland lands of east Asia, consisting of hamster species inclusive of the common Syrian hamster and the miniature Russian dwarf hamster. Hamsters in the wild generally tend to spend most in their time digging and foraging for meals.
these days, hamsters are generally kept as pets with the average family hamster getting to around 2 or 3 years old. Hamsters are thought to be smooth first pets to preserve for children due to the hamsters pretty nature, small length and calm temperament.
Hamsters are solitary animals. some sorts of hamster are so solitary that they will combat to the demise if more than one hamster is within the same territory.
Hamsters in the wild are nocturnal animals as the hamsters spend the daylight hours in burrows underground in order for the hamster to avoid the numerous predators within the herbal environment of the hamster.The hamster will leave the protection of its underground burrow inside the night while it's miles dark and the temperature is cooler with a purpose to look for meals.
Hamsters use their massive cheek pouches to store meals that the hamster finds so that the hamster can take the food returned to the stash in the underground burrow. Nuts, seeds, greens, grass, end result and berries are all a part of the herbal food plan of the hamster.
There are greater than 20 different species of hamster found within the wild (or even more in the industrial pet market). The Russian dwarf hamster are most of the smallest species of hamster with person Russian dwarf hamsters not often growing to greater than 10cm in duration. The greater common Syrian hamster is the biggest species of hamster and a few Syrian hamster people have been known to develop to nearly 30cm long, although the common length of a Syrian hamster is normally around 20cm.
Many species of hamster are very rapid at going for walks so that they're able to break out from oncoming predators. because of the form and size of the hind feet of the hamster, hamsters are frequently able to run as fast backwards as they are able to forwards, which the lets in the hamsters to escape effortlessly of their burrows.
Hamsters inhabit semi-desert regions round the sector with the tender floor supplying an first rate cloth for the hamster to burrow in. The burrow of a hamster frequently consists of many tunnels and chambers, including separate regions for the hamster to consume and sleep in.
Hamster Foot facts
The hamster has two the front ft that are formed more like arms and the hamster uses its front feet to preserve and forage for food.
the 2 returned feet of the hamster are barely larger than the front toes and are used to balance and guide the hamster when it sits up.
The sensitive shape of the back ft of the hamster enable the hamster to run not most effective forwards but also backwards in order that the hamster can without problems get away into burrows.
The fingers of the hamster are properly tailored to their purpose as they have 5 feet on every hand, in which the toes of the hamster most effective have 3.
Hamsters have smooth pads on the lowest of their paws that assist them to run easily, and lengthy nails on the give up of each toe which facilitates the hamster to grip.
Hamster teeth information
As hamsters are rodents, their tooth are growing all the time so hamsters have to grind their teeth all the way down to forestall them from getting too long through gnawing on some thing difficult.
Hamsters have 16 teeth that continuously grow to present the hamster an advantage if it loses a enamel.
not like many different species of animal toddler hamsters are born with a full set of teeth and maintain the equal enamel for their complete lives.
Hamsters have cheek pouches that they save food in whilst they may be out foraging and empty their pouches afterward which will eat their stored food.
